Ticket: Staging env misconfigured for Siftgate bloom filter

The bloom layer in front of the Pellet KV store is rejecting all lookups in staging because the env file was copied from the dev template without credentials. False-positive tuning values are fine; only the auth line is missing. To unblock the weekly demo, the Pellet admission secret must be set on the following line.

env line for yaguf-fajop: LEDGER_TOKEN13=fb08984397349

**Q: How do I unlock the encrypted offline bundle when reviewing Trailnote's sync code?**

A: The field-survey app caches submissions in an encrypted local store. Reviewers testing offline mode need the staging recovery key, not a production one. Check out the `offline-review` branch, run the bundle tool, and when prompted for credentials, use the staging recovery passphrase given directly below.

recovery phrase for tagug-yagug: lamox-gilax-keleth-gilath

**Q: Why does the waveform preview show a flat line for some uploads?**

A: WaveGlint renders previews only after transcoding finishes. Flat lines usually mean the job is still queued or the file has a silent first channel. Have the user re-upload or wait five minutes. If the preview stays flat after transcoding completes, escalate with the file's job number to the address below.

escalation mailbox, yafog-kafof: eliok@xolmarcloud.local

Capacity note for authors building validators on the Siftwell plugin platform. Each validator runs in a sandboxed worker, and the scheduler packs workers by declared memory class, so accurate declarations directly affect how many concurrent validations your plugin gets. Heavy regex or schema-graph validators should opt into the large class rather than risk eviction mid-run. Undeclared plugins default to the small class. Before publishing, check your plugin against the per-class resource ceilings, which are defined as follows.

tuning constants:
QUOTAS = {
    "druwyn": 5,
    "holix": 5,
    "zorath": 5,
    "holwyn": 10,
}

Runbook: The Brindlecore firmware update channel pushes signed images to field devices in staged cohorts. As a contractor, never promote an image from canary to broad without two approvals. If a cohort reports boot loops, pause the channel from the fleet console and roll back to the last known-good image. Every rollback must reference the firmware build recorded below.

session token of yahof-bajeg = htk9_0d43d44ed